Audio content analysis is the process of using artificial intelligence and machine learning to automatically transcribe, categorize, and derive meaning from audio files and streams. It involves technologies like automatic speech recognition (ASR), natural language processing (NLP), and sentiment analysis to convert speech into structured, searchable data. This enables businesses to unlock valuable insights from customer calls, meetings, podcasts, and multimedia archives for improved decision-making and operational efficiency.
Raw audio data from calls, recordings, or streams is ingested and cleaned for optimal processing quality by the analysis engine.
Advanced algorithms perform speech-to-text conversion, entity recognition, topic modeling, and sentiment detection on the transcribed content.
The system outputs structured reports, visual dashboards, and actionable intelligence based on the analyzed themes, trends, and metadata.
Analyze support calls to identify common complaints, agent performance gaps, and opportunities for process improvement and training.
Automatically transcribe and tag podcast or broadcast content for SEO, accessibility compliance, and content discovery.
Monitor recorded communications in regulated industries for policy adherence, sensitive data mentions, and compliance reporting.
Extract themes and sentiment from focus group recordings or interview audio to understand consumer trends and brand perception.
Transcribe and analyze internal meetings to track action items, participation, and discussion topics for better knowledge management.

Pricing varies based on audio volume, analysis depth, and required turnaround, often structured per audio hour or via monthly subscription. Basic transcription services start lower, while advanced sentiment, multi-speaker, and real-time analysis command premium rates. Request detailed quotes to compare provider pricing models.
Modern AI speech recognition achieves over 90% accuracy for clear audio in common languages, though accents, background noise, and technical jargon can affect results. Leading providers use domain-specific language models and human-in-the-loop verification to enhance accuracy for critical business applications.
Most platforms support common formats like MP3, WAV, and AAC, and offer analysis for dozens of major global languages. Support for dialects, real-time streaming APIs, and industry-specific terminology varies by provider, so verifying technical specifications is crucial for your use case.
Processing time depends on file duration, complexity, and provider infrastructure, ranging from near-real-time to several hours for large batches. Providers with scalable cloud infrastructure can process thousands of hours concurrently, offering clear SLAs for delivery timelines.
Basic transcription only converts speech to text, while full audio content analysis adds layers like speaker diarization, sentiment scoring, topic extraction, and trend visualization. The latter transforms raw audio into structured, queryable business intelligence for strategic insights.
